Camping Village Conca d'Oro
This campsite on the shores of Lake Maggiore is a beloved destination for families and nature lovers, with many guests returning year after year. The location offers stunning lake and mountain views, direct access to a sandy beach, and a peaceful atmosphere, especially after 11 pm. The pitches are consistently described as large, spacious, and often shaded by trees, providing ample privacy and comfort. The staff receive high praise for being exceptionally friendly, helpful, and multilingual, with a notable example of arranging medical assistance for a guest. Facilities are modern and meticulously clean, including sanitary buildings and showers. The on-site amenities feature several bar-restaurants serving good food, particularly excellent pizzas, a shop with fresh bread and croissants, and activities for children. The campsite is very child-friendly and offers guided walks and a cycle path to the nearby town of Feriolo. Long-time visitors note that the campsite has evolved positively over the years while retaining its charm. Mosquitoes can be a minor issue, and some reviews mention dated toilets or high prices, but the overwhelming majority describe a spotless, spacious, and friendly campsite that feels like a home away from home. In 2021, staff interactions were criticized by some, but subsequent years show consistent improvement. Overall, the campsite provides excellent value for money, with a calm environment and impressive lake access.
